THERE will be a new men’s singles winner in the 92nd ODDA Winter League finals at Cowley Workers Social Club on Friday.

The contest sees Geordie Grant (Cowley Workers) take on fellow first-time finalist Andrew Quinn, from Queens Head.

Grant is an established Oxfordshire player, while Quinn broke into the county team this season after an impressive run in the Super League.

The ladies’ singles final sees Carol Smith (Witney Snooker Club) trying to retain the title she won in the 2016/17 season.

She takes on first-time finalist Caroline Caldicutt (Red Lion, Cassington), who has shown impressive form in the league this season.

In the men’s pairs final, Joe Palmer and Dave Fowler, from Premier Section champions Kidlington Green, take on Mark Breakspear and Simon Smith, from Abingdon United SC.

Blackbird Bar duo of Chris and Sharon Thompson play in their sixth ladies’ pairs final against Carol Smith and Greta Britnell, of Witney Snooker Club.

The men’s seven-a-side pits Premier side Abingdon United SC against underdogs Littlemore Rugby Club, from Section 2.

The ladies’ final is a local derby between Blackbird Bar and neighbours Blackbird Leys Bowls Club.

The mixed pairs decider will see Kidlington Football Club’s Rob Smith and Katrina Blackman meet the Blackbird Leys Bowls Club pairing of Alan Hunter and Debbie Stevens.

The finals start at 7.30pm.
